Good morning,

I have some questions regarding rt-mailgate, hope you will be able to help
me.

I tried to configured it as said in the RT 4-2-0 documentation. I have two
queue on my RT-environment “Support” and “R&D”.

I added on /etc/aliases the following content:

rt: "|/opt/rt4/bin/rt-mailgate --queue Support --action correspond

  •          --url http://10.0.30.214 <http://10.0.30.214>"*
    

rt-comment: "|/opt/rt4/bin/rt-mailgate --queue Support --action comment

  •          --url http://10.0.30.214 <http://10.0.30.214>"*
    

What I need now it’s an example of email creation, like how should I need
to fill my email to create the new ticket in the queue “Support”.

It looks like what you need to do is send an email (with any subject line and any content) to your aliased address, which would be:

rt@rtbox.yourdomain.commailto:rt@rtbox.yourdomain.com

One suggestion…you might consider using alias names that matches your queue name, so you can have more than one active queue.

In other words, something more like…

support: ‘|/opt/rt4/bin/rt-mailgate --queue Support --action correspond …’
support-comment: ‘|/opt/rt4/bin/rt-mailgate --queue Support -action comment …’

And then you’d send email to support@rtbox.yourdomain.commailto:support@rtbox.yourdomain.com or support-comment@rtbox.yourdomain.commailto:support-comment@rtbox.yourdomain.com .
